Applies ToAccess para Microsoft 365 Access 2024 Access 2021 Access 2019 Access 2016

Devolve uma Variante (Data) contendo a data do sistema atual.

Sintaxe

Data

Observações

Para definir a data do sistema, utilize a instrução Data .

Se utilizar a função Data com um calendário Gregoriano, o comportamento de Date$ não será alterado pela definição da propriedade Calendário . Se o calendário for Hijri, Date$ devolve uma cadeia de 10 carateres do formulário mm-dd-aaaa, em que mm (01-12), dd (01-30) e aaaa (1400-1523) são o mês, dia e ano hijri. A gama gregoriana equivalente é de 1 de janeiro de 1980 a 31 de dezembro de 2099.

Exemplos de consulta

Expressão

Resultados

SELECT Date() AS Expr1 FROM ProductSales GROUP BY Date();

Devolve a "data" do sistema atual para no formato de data abreviada. Resultado: "dd/mm/aaaa".

SELECT Date()-[DateofSale] AS DaysSinceSale FROM ProductSales;

Devolve a diferença entre os valores de "Data" e data do sistema atual do campo "DateofSale" como número e apresenta os resultados na coluna "DaySinceSale".

Exemplos de VBA

Utilizar Data numa expressão     Pode utilizar a função Data onde quer que possa utilizar expressões. Por exemplo, pode definir a propriedade Origem do Controlo de uma caixa de texto num formulário da seguinte forma:

=Data()

Quando o formulário está aberto na vista Formulário, a caixa de texto apresenta a data atual do sistema.

Utilizar a função Date no código VBA    

Nota: Os exemplos seguintes demonstram a utilização desta função no módulo VBA (Visual Basic for Applications). Para obter mais informações sobre como trabalhar com o VBA, selecione Referência para Programadores na lista pendente junto a Procurar e introduza um ou mais termos na caixa de pesquisa.

Este exemplo utiliza a função Data para devolver a data atual do sistema.

Dim MyDateMyDate = Date    ' MyDate contains the current system date.

Escolher a função de data correta

Precisa de mais ajuda?

Quer mais opções?

Explore os benefícios da subscrição, navegue em cursos de formação, saiba como proteger o seu dispositivo e muito mais.

As comunidades ajudam-no a colocar e a responder perguntas, a dar feedback e a ouvir especialistas com conhecimentos abrangentes.